Mira Costa High School (MCHS, "Costa") is a four-year public high school located in Manhattan Beach, California that first opened 1950. It is the only high school in the Manhattan Beach Unified School District. The school's athletic teams are known as the Mustangs and the school colors are green and gold.

Congratulations to the Mira Costa Class of 2024! 🎓 We’re incredibly proud of our 619 graduates for reaching this milestone. 🎉 This year, we celebrated 81 students earning Magna Cum Laude (3.8 - 3.99) and 282 earning Summa Cum Laude (4.0+), achieving an outstanding 99.5% graduation rate!
